We purchased a 2020 3867MKOK and after a year we discovered three issues. The first was that the Black tank cleanout piping was reversed between tank 1 and two. Dealer fixed that easily. The second issue was discovered while getting it inspected. A grease seal leaked on one of the wheels. Since I could drive it to the dealer, Forrest River told me to pay the repair bill and they would reimburse me. I got the check a week later. Great service. The last issue is there are some hydraulic fluid drops in the well where all the hoses are located. We have an appointment with the dealer in the spring to have that looked at. Considering all the "Stuff" this thing has, I'm satisfied with the quality and factory support.

I Purchased this RV as our families first in the summer of 2019. This was bought brand new off of the lot in Maryland which was only three hours away from my most local dealer who wanted $10,000 more for the same exact model.
After purchasing the RV we took a few trips in it, and late Summer we sprung a hydraulic leak when leaving from a trip.
After three months of arguing with forest river(entire fall camping season) they finally picked it up brought it to Indiana to have it “repaired“.
I was initially told that I had to take it four (4) hours away to have repairs done because their dealers do not have to adhere to the warranty terms or repairs unless it was purchased directly from them. I actually had a local dealer try to shake me down for $250 to bring it in under warranty repair and Forrest River did nothing .
They finally picked it up three months after being notified, and brought it to Indiana to have it repaired this winter. It was returned in two months with a notification that everything was repaired.
This summer we are just planing for our first trip and while De-winterizing it; the undercarriage filled up with about 60 or so gallons of water.
Needless to say if I could give this thing back yesterday I would. Do not purchase a forest river product!
They are built like crap, and their customer service is even worse.
Do you self a favor purchase something different. I’ve been unfortunate enough to be paying for an RV for 11 months and I’ve only been able to use it four times.
